Just a quick word about this years Auto Assembly Transformers convention, which was held in Birmingham last month. What an absolutely fantastic weekend!! I was there along with my partners in superheroics Jason Cardy and Kat Nicholson. It was great to catch up with fellow guests, such as Mike Collins, Liam Shalloo, Kris Carter, Lee Bradley, Andrew Wildman, Lee Sullivan, and Lew Stringer. It was also awesome to finally meet Nick Roche as well... Nick of course is the ultra talented and popular artist on many of IDW's TRANSFORMERS comics, and is a really nice guy.
Of course, it goes without saying that the highlight of the weekend to many in attendance was meeting the awesome Gregg Berger. Gregg is better known to Transformers fandom as the voice of Grimlock from the classic TRANSFORMERS cartoon. I have to say that Gregg is one of the nicest people you could ever wish to meet, and is an absolute star.
I also had the pleasure of participating in a script reading (written by none other than SIMON FURMAN!) along with Gregg, Nick, and TRANSFORMERS: BEAST WARS actor Ian James Corlett... who is the voice of Cheetor from the popular show. This was another highlight for me... and BIG hats off to the other guys who joined us on stage, and provided AWESOME voices for the script! Thanks to EVERYONE who made this weekend one of the best of my life... from the fellow guests, organisers to everyone who came up and said hello. You're ALL stars :)
